Butter Crust Corn Pie

Prep Time:25 mins
Cook Time:45 mins
Total Time:70 mins
Servings: 6

Ingredients

  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 cup unsalted butter (cold, cubed)
  • 4 tablespoons ice water
  • 0.5 teaspoons salt
  • 2 cups corn kernels (fresh, canned, or frozen and thawed)
  • 0.5 cup heavy cream
  • 1 cup cheddar cheese (shredded)
  • 2 large eggs
  • 0.25 cup green onions (chopped)
  • 2 cloves garlic (minced)
  • 0.5 teaspoons paprika
  • 0.5 teaspoons black pepper
  • 0.5 teaspoons salt

Directions

Step 1

In a large mixing bowl, combine the all-purpose flour and 0.5 teaspoons of salt.

Step 2

Add the cold, cubed butter to the flour and cut it in using a pastry cutter or your fingertips until the mixture resembles coarse crumbs.

Step 3

Gradually add the ice water, one tablespoon at a time, mixing gently until the dough comes together.

Step 4

Form the dough into a disc, wrap it in plastic wrap, and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es.

Step 5

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C).

Step 6

Roll out the chilled dough on a lightly floured surface into a circle large enough to fit a 9-inch pie pan.

Step 7

Transfer the dough to the pie pan and trim any excess overhang. Crimp the edges if desired.

Step 8

In a medium mixing bowl, whisk together the eggs and heavy cream until well combined.

Step 9

Stir in the corn kernels, shredded cheddar cheese, chopped green onions, minced garlic, paprika, black pepper, and 0.5 teaspoons of salt.

Step 10

Pour the filling mixture into the prepared pie crust, spreading it out evenly.

Step 11

Bake the pie in the preheated oven for 40–45 minutes, or until the crust is golden brown and the filling is set.

Step 12

Remove the pie from the oven and let it cool for 10–15 minutes before slicing.

Step 13

Serve warm and enjoy your delicious Butter Crust Corn Pie!
